Proof of Exposure

Proof of exposure links the medication to the injury, typically requiring prescription histories, pharmacy records, patient timelines, and medical notes demonstrating when symptoms began. Documentation may include drug labels, batch numbers, and discharge summaries that show causation and timing, helping establish liability and the potential scope of compensation.

Adverse Drug Event

An adverse drug event refers to harm caused by a medication that may occur unexpectedly. The term helps distinguish injury from ordinary side effects and supports discussions about product safety, labeling, and the responsibilities of manufacturers and sellers in preventing harm.

Causation and Liability

Causation and liability describe how a specific drug is shown to cause injury and who may be legally responsible, including manufacturers, distributors, or prescribers. Clarifying causation helps determine possible compensation for medical costs, lost wages, and related damages.

Labeling, Warnings, and Safety Data

Labeling, warnings, and safety data encompass the information provided with a medication about risks, interactions, and precautions. Assessing the adequacy of labeling helps determine whether a company failed to warn customers, which may influence liability and the strength of a claim.

Stevens-Johnson syndrome (SJS) represents a severe and potentially life-threatening condition that impacts the skin and mucous membranes. When this condition progresses to its most dangerous variant, toxic epidermal necrolysis (TEN), mortality rates can range from 30-80%. In most cases, these reactions stem from adverse responses to pharmaceutical medications.
